You can also reuse separate elements of your drawing multiple times in one scene, by saving them. Theres a multifunctional zoom, hand and rotate tool for scene movement, but a simple mousewheel control for the zoom would be welcome. The Contour Editor tool can add, remove or modify points on a vector line and control them with Bzier handles which, while useful, was occasionally awkward to use. Theres also a Shape tool, to draw with circles, lines and squares.īasic transformations such as repositioning, rotating, scaling or perspective skewing can be carried out using the different handles of the bounding box. This is useful when youre fixing a drawing or using lots of brush strokes to build up a shape.
